Mendocino College Overview
Located in Ukiah, California, Mendocino College is a public institution. Mendocino College is located in the countryside, which is perfect for students who enjoy a rural lifestyle.
What Is Mendocino College Known For?
- The associate's degree is the highest award offered at Mendocino College.
- During a recent academic cycle, 22% of the faculty were full-time.

Mendocino College Undergraduate Student Diversity
Gender Diversity
Of the 799 full-time undergraduates at Mendocino College, 32% are male and 68% are female.
Racial-Ethnic Diversity
The racial-ethnic breakdown of Mendocino College students is as follows.
| Race/Ethnicity | Number of Grads |
|---|---|
| Asian | 36 |
| Black or African American | 9 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 370 |
| White | 319 |
| International Students | 2 |
| Other Races/Ethnicities | 63 |
